Here’s how much it costs to build a PC:

PC case: $30-$100 ($50 average)

Motherboard: $30-$130 ($55 average)

Processor (CPU): $100-$300 ($150 average)

RAM (memory): $30-$100 ($50 average)

Hard drive (HDD): $50-$200 ($100 average)
